Truss Framing in Kansas City, KS
Truss framing services involve the construction and installation of prefabricated triangular structural frameworks that support the roof or floor systems of a building. These trusses are designed to evenly distribute weight and provide stability, making them essential for a variety of projects such as new home construction, roof replacements, or additions. Homeowners typically request truss framing to ensure a strong, reliable foundation for their roofing structures, especially when custom designs or larger spans are involved.
Property owners considering truss framing usually want to understand the types of trusses suitable for their project, the materials used, and how the framing integrates with existing structures. It’s important to consider factors like load requirements, architectural style, and any local building codes that may influence the choice of trusses. Clear communication about project scope and structural needs can help ensure the framing supports the overall safety and durability of the property.

Truss Framing Questions
What is truss framing used for? Truss framing is commonly used to create strong, stable roof structures for residential and commercial buildings.
What types of projects typically require truss framing? Truss framing is ideal for new home construction, roof replacements, and large-scale remodeling projects.
How does truss framing benefit property owners? It provides a durable support system that can span large distances, allowing for flexible interior layouts.
What should property owners consider before choosing truss framing? It's important to evaluate the design needs and structural requirements of the building to ensure proper framing choices.
